What side effects can this medication cause?
Possible side effects from rituximab may include:
fever, rigors and chills
nausea
hives
fatigue
headache
itching
vomiting
decreased blood pressure
pain at the site of the tumor
Tell your doctor if any of these symptoms are severe or do not go away:
nausea or vomiting
weakness
headache
flushing
dizziness
If you experience any of the following symptoms, call your doctor immediately:
an allergic reaction (including difficulty breathing; closing of the throat; swelling of the lips, tongue, or face; low blood pressure; or hives)
lung problems (difficulty breathing, shortness of breath, increased coughing, or chest pain)
heart problems (irregular heart beats, chest pain)
little or no urine production (may indicate kidney problems)
unusual bleeding or bruising
fever or chills
a rash or skin reaction
Other side effects have also been reported. It is important that you discuss with your doctor any side effect that occurs during treatment with rituximab.
